What is Robotic Process Automation (RPA)?

Robotic process automation is the use of specialized computer programs, known as software robots, to automate and standardize repeatable business processes. Imagine a robot sitting in front of a computer looking at the same applications and performing the same keystrokes as a person would. While Robotic process automation does not involve any form of physical robots, software robots mimic human activities by interacting with applications in the same way that a person does.
Working as a virtual business assistant, bots complete tedious tasks, freeing up time for employees to concentrate on more engaging, revenue-generating tasks. Part of the beauty of robotic process automation technology is that it offers even non-technical employees the tools to configure their own software robots to solve automation challenges.
Robotic process automation enables business professionals to easily configure software robots to automate repetitive, routine work between multiple systems, filling in automation gaps to improve business processes. These “bots” work directly across application user interfaces, mimicking the actions a person would perform, including logging in and out of applications, copying and pasting data, opening emails and attachments, and filling out forms.
While this may sound similar to screen-scraping and macros software technology, RPA has evolved beyond these solutions. For example, while macros use fixed, linear commands, bots have the flexibility to intuitively respond to stimuli and changes in business processes—increasing their intelligence over time. Also, in cases where you need multiple tools to run scripts that perform across multiple applications, RPA can simplify the way users automate tasks by interacting with multiple applications at once.
The dynamic nature of RPA sets it apart from previously developed automation solutions, making it an important automation tool that drives digital transformation and the future of work.
As a user-friendly and cost-effective tool, robotic process automation provides a number of advantages that are drawing interest from organizations across many industries.
RPA has advanced significantly, and future generations of the technology will only bring additional value. Advanced cognitive capabilities such as machine learning and artificial intelligence are allowing bots to more intelligently interpret the interfaces they work across, better handle errors, and manipulate unstructured data.
Machine learning allows bots to recognize patterns over time. This means that when a process requires human intervention, a bot can learn and act autonomously when these situations arise again.
RPA is a versatile, scalable technology that can apply to many different departments and industry processes.
